My Trip from Couch to Tough Mudder: Week 2

Cardio and biking and diets, oh my!

Despite being cleared on Tuesday to start running again, I focused this week on low-impact cardio exercises. The weather over the weekend was just too nice not to go for a bike ride, and the weather the rest of the week was wreaking havoc on my poor knees. I can't wait until I start physical therapy, as it should clear a lot of these issues up. Here's what my week looked like:

  • Day 1: Thirty minutes on the elliptical at the gym. Also tossed in a few reps on the weight lifting machines. I almost fell off my seat when I saw some guns popping out of my arms!
  • Day 2: Pitifully short bike ride on the . My quads were killing me and then my bike chain fell off. Went to  who kindly fixed it for me, and then readjusted my seat and handlebar height after I was complaining wildly about my poor quads. Apparently it should not hurt that badly. (I seem to keep repeating this statement, hrmm.)
  • Day 3: Back on the bike! This time I brought a friend. Between her pushing me and the adjustments to my bike, I was able to go 7 miles! That's more than twice what I was doing before.
  • Day 4: Working out at home, I did the Slim in 6 workout (why do my arms keep burning when I do this, arggh!).
  • Day 5: Fit Club at the . We did Brazil Butt Lift. The lambada works your bum like nothing else.
  • Day 6: Off day.
  • Day 7: Got my set of Hip Hop Abs in the mail so of course I had to do that :) Those workouts are so much fun you can barely tell it's exercise (until the next day, of course!).

After loading up on all sorts of healthy goodness at the grocery store last week I spent a lot of time focusing on eating better. Now that I'm working my body extra hard I need to give it the right fuel, plus I'll bum myself out if I work out this much and don't lose any weight (that's pretty common). I upped my fruit and vegetable intake, cut down portion sizes, and even switched to drinking red wine instead of hard liquor when going out (I think the crew at were pretty shocked at that one). My two biggest hurdles are eating too many carbs and too little protein, but I'll keep at it. On a side note, I am down 4 pounds since I started this two weeks ago. Not too shabby, eh?
